Color Inspiration


  

            source: CMYK, issue 23, back cover, PeteMcArthur.com

     This photograph illustrates some examples of color theory quite well. First, the warm color of red hair or orange comes forward, while the blue/purple background recedes. The focal point of the yellow bow relates to the intensity and purity characteristic of the yellow hue. The middle ground uses blue, red, white and black, this creates a color interaction that recedes and advances. Overall the split color scheme creates a color environment and atmosphere. The light source creates an effect on the colors similar to that of the opponent theory of color giving this image an electric glow. The image has some whimsical harmonies that for me seem to resolve in tension, disharmony, or a veiled mystery, and that is why along with the vibrant colors is why I made this choice.
